BT are known to throttle p2p speed:(...do speeds pick up if you download outside of peak hours? The article below will tell you BT's peak times & there's also some info about their bandwidth management. BT Broadband -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ia Also see UK Bob's posts in this thread. http://www.gnutellaforums.com/connec...ewire-pro.html There are a couple of things you could try but to be honest, it's probably not going to make much difference...you could try changing ports (in LW tools > options > advanced > firewall config, change listening port to 64049 or something in the range of 49152 - 65535 > Apply > ok). Do you see the firewall icon (brick wall in front of the blue globe)? If so, you could also try port forwarding for your Home Hub. The instructions are here. Port Forwarding for the BT Home Hub LW's listening port, port in the 'manual port forward' box & port forwarded within the Home Hub all have to be the same number;) |
